Drupal for Designers: Speaking each other's language DrupalCon Portland 2022
Speaker: Mayeda Khan
As a developer, have you ever received designs for a Drupal site that make no sense or need to be hard coded due to the lack of a contributed module? As a designer, have you ever gotten lost in the jargon of it all? Do both teams ever felt the need for better site planning before embarking on a Drupal-based project?
When we think of Drupal, we automatically think of web development. While this is true, we often overlook a very crucial step of the process - design. In a world where human-centered interactions lay the foundation for all decisions we make on a product, it is crucial we also include designers in this conversation. Speaking each other’s language and having an understanding of the design AND development phase is vital to the success of any web development project. This session will highlight the design and development process from a designer’s standpoint in hopes of breaking down the silos that exist between both teams and the barriers of communication. Some of the topics we will discuss are the Drupal site planning phase during discovery, user experience within Drupal frameworks, content creation and entities, visual design and templates, Drupal development vocabulary for designers, and CMS usability.
Depending on your team, project needs, and budget, these steps can vary. However, the one thing that remains true to both is that we must understand Drupal fundamentals along each step in order to be successful designers and work effectively across teams.
As a developer, have you ever received designs for a Drupal site that make no sense or need to be hard coded due to the lack of a contributed module? As a designer, have you ever gotten lost in the jargon of it all? Do both teams ever felt the need for better site planning before embarking on a Drupal-based project?
When we think of Drupal, we automatically think of web development. While this is true, we often overlook a very crucial step of the process - design. In a world where human-centered interactions lay the foundation for all decisions we make on a product, it is crucial we also include designers in this conversation. Speaking each other’s language and having an understanding of the design AND development phase is vital to the success of any web development project. This session will highlight the design and development process from a designer’s standpoint in hopes of breaking down the silos that exist between both teams and the barriers of communication. Some of the topics we will discuss are the Drupal site planning phase during discovery, user experience within Drupal frameworks, content creation and entities, visual design and templates, Drupal development vocabulary for designers, and CMS usability.
Depending on your team, project needs, and budget, these steps can vary. However, the one thing that remains true to both is that we must understand Drupal fundamentals along each step in order to be successful designers and work effectively across teams.